Kelly Clarkson, a name synonymous with raw vocal power and emotionally-charged lyrics, takes us on a journey of liberation and self-discovery with ‘Catch My Breath’. Diving beyond the pop anthem’s catchy hooks lies a deeper, textual narrative, etching Clarkson’s claim of independence and contentment in one’s own skin.

The track, veiled in the guise of radio-friendly production, is not just another pop song to tap your feet to; it’s a declaration of Clarkson’s freedom from the shackles of expectation, a story of finding peace within, and truly embracing the beauty of living on one’s own terms.

Embracing Freedom: The Core of Clarkson’s Vivid Proclamation

Understanding ‘Catch My Breath’ requires an appreciation of its backdrop – a whirlwind of fame where autonomy is often sacrificed at the altar of public image. Clarkson captures a moment of clarity amid the chaos, where she sees the beauty in steering her own destiny, disregarding the ill-fitting molds the world has attempted to constrain her with.

The recurring phrase ‘catch my breath’ serves both literally and figuratively, symbolizing a pause from life’s relentless pace to acknowledge her needs and desires. It’s a powerful metaphor for reclaiming one’s life.

The Web of Lies and The Quest for Honesty

‘Catching breath in a web of lies’ encapsulates Kelly’s struggle with the facade often expected in the entertainment industry. She addresses the pressures of maintaining a facade, one that is woven so intricately it’s almost suffocating.

This line resonates with anyone who has ever felt obligated to present a version of themselves that aligns with others’ expectations at the cost of their authenticity. Clarkson’s lyrics serve as a reminder that it’s never too late to untangle oneself and seek truth.

Unveiling The Hidden Meaning: A Narrative of Growth and Strength

Beneath the surface of this pop powerhouse anthem lies a riveting chronicle of Kelly Clarkson’s own evolution. ‘Catch My Breath’ is not simply a statement about personal freedom; it’s the culmination of a voyage through skepticism, the struggles of fame, and ultimately, self-acceptance.

Each stanza weaves a richer, less-visible tapestry detailing the dichotomy of her lived experiences – the ‘heavy heart’ transformed into a ‘weightless cloud’, signalling the shift from burden to enlightenment and the tranquil acceptance of her newfound love for self.

The Mantra for Resilience: ‘No one can hold me back’

Perhaps the most defining and instantly memorable line, ‘No one can hold me back, I ain’t got time for that’ is an outright rejection of negativity and obstacles. Clarkson refuses to be bogged down by naysayers or the constructs of the industry.

It’s a mantra for resilience, self-assurance, and the relentless pursuit of one’s own happiness. This line embodies the spirit of the song, an assertive shove against the chest of any force that dares to stifle her growth or cloud her journey.

The Transformation from Pop Idol to Purveyor of Personal Truth

‘You helped me see / The beauty in everything’ marks a transformative point in the song. This gratitude for enlightenment suggests the impact of a mentor, friend, or perhaps a version of her former self—a guiding force that shepherds the realization of her true essence and potential.

It’s a lyrical acknowledgment of the power in positive influence and a nod to the introspective transformation that can emerge from supportive relationships, self-reflection, and steadfast determination to live authentically.
